Output e8e786ce2fde751d4db01a9edced283f361a81ba9a7f2fb14c8f835cf2e4dea0:0

value
17754190
script pubkey
OP_0 OP_PUSHBYTES_20 a886cdcb0a77b0553a956b8aa63db0175fe7a45b
address
bc1q4zrvmjc2w7c92w54dw92v0dsza070fzmdnx9km
transaction
e8e786ce2fde751d4db01a9edced283f361a81ba9a7f2fb14c8f835cf2e4dea0
confirmations
266120
spent
true